			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>People who care navigate their exotic vehicles through the local area to raise $30,000<br />
By Nick Lees, Edmonton Journal | July 14, 2010 6:17 AM<br />
<a href="http://www.ffb.ca/documents/File/events/Edmonton%20Journal_14JUL10.pdf">View a copy of Nick Lees&#8217; Edmonton Journal article at FFB.ca</a></p>
<p>Jack&#8217;s Grill owner Mark Goodwin offered to prepare a meal for 60 people.<br />
Wade Brintnell of The Wine Cellar provided voluptuous wines.</p>
<p>And some 26 drivers and navigators roared away in exotic sports cars to fight blindness.<br />
&#8220;Our first child Erick, who is now six, was born with a rare, inherited retinal disorder called leber<br />
congenital amaurosis (LCA),&#8221; says Nadine Seed. &#8220;It meant he was born blind with no hope of a cure.<br />
&#8220;This rocked our world and we began to find out as much as we could about Erick&#8217;s ailment.&#8221; Nadine<br />
and her husband, Mike Seed, discovered groundbreaking research was being carried out in Canada<br />
and the United States that provided hope of a cure.</p>
<p>The couple decided to become involved in helping fund researchers and that led to them talking to<br />
members of the Foundation Fighting Blindness. &#8220;The foundation&#8217;s mandate is to find the causes,<br />
treatments and ultimately the cures for retinitis pimentos, macular degeneration and related retinal<br />
diseases by supporting research and public awareness,&#8221; says Seed.<br />
On Sunday, the sports cars roared away on the couple&#8217;s inaugural fundraiser, a scavenger hunt called<br />
Drive For Sight.</p>
<p>Ivor Lammerink from the Porsche Club mapped out the route that wound its way around the country<br />
southeast of Edmonton, says Seed. &#8220;Questions were asked such as the distance between New Sarepta, the village made more famous by former Journal cartoonist Yardley Jones, to the Northern<br />
Bear Golf Course.&#8221;<br />
The event raised more than $30,000, says Seed. Next year&#8217;s event is being planned.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>We raised $30,000 to help the<a href="http://www.ffb.ca/research/current.html"> Foundation Fighting Blindness</a> support the leading edge retinal research currently underway by <a href="http://www.thechildren.com/en/research/mch.aspx?myID=73&amp;utm_source=2010+Drive+For+Sight&amp;utm_campaign=1329ca8e07-DFS_15_18_2010&amp;utm_medium=email" target="_blank">Dr. Robert Koenekoop</a> at the Montreal Children&#8217;s Hospital.  Dr. Koenekoop is the Principal Investigator and Director of the McGill Ocular Genetics Laboratory and Chief of Pediatric Ophthalmology.</p>
<p>Dr. Koenekoop is one of the leading researchers in the world in the area of inherited retinal degenerative disease that causes blindness from birth. We are very fortunate to have such a valuable talent here in Canada.</p>
<p>The purpose of this [Foundation Fight Blindness] grant is to discovery new genes and treatments for Leber congenital amaurosis (LCA) &amp; retinitis pigmentosa (RP) by using a successful gene-hunting program.  This program was developed with FFB support and has allowed Dr. Koenekoop to identify six new LCA and RP genes in the past three years. Gene identification leads to new understanding of how photoreceptors live and die, and to gene-specific therapies, which have recently led to the successful rescue of photoreceptors and vision in LCA patients.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Nadine Seed was chosen as a winner of Today&#8217;s Parent magazine &#8220;For Kids&#8217; Sake- Reader with a Cause&#8221; writing contest. Her entry described her shock after finding out her child had a disability at birth, and her desperate search to find a cure.</p>
<p>As a result, $2000 was awarded to Nadine&#8217;s chosen charity, one that supports Nadine&#8217;s special cause- the search for a cure for blindness.  Her charity of choice is The Foundation Fighting Blindness Canada (FFB).</p>
<p>The FFB is a national charitable organization formed to find the causes, treatments and ultimately the cures for retinitis pigmentosa, macular degeneration and related retinal diseases by supporting research and building public awareness.  It is their goal to restore the gift of vision in children who were robbed of it.</p>
<p>Nadine appreciated the opportunity to have her cause and chosen charity be featured in such a widely read and influential national magazine, as well as the generous donation of $2000 that went to the Foundation Fighting Blindness.</p>
